About The Position

Pastry Cook is responsible for preparing and presenting a variety of high-quality pastries, desserts, breads, and other baked goods. This role involves executing recipes with precision, maintaining consistency, and contributing to the creation of visually stunning and flavorful desserts that align with the hotel’s luxury brand standards.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are a wide range of pastries, desserts, and baked goods, such as cakes, tarts, macarons, croissants, breads, and plated desserts to meet to luxury culinary standards.
  • Execute recipes with precision, ensuring consistency in flavor, texture, and presentation.
  • Create visually appealing dessert presentations, incorporating intricate plating techniques and garnishes.
  • Ensure an efficient service, ensuring all ingredients and equipment are ready for high volume service.
  • Maintain an organized and efficient pastry station, including all the ingredient preparation and the equipment set up.
  • Operate and care for pastry-specific equipment, such as mixers, ovens, proofers, and tempering machines.
  • Keep the station clean, organized and compliant with health and safety standards during high volume service periods.
  • Oversee the daily operations of your kitchen section, including inventory and equipment maintenance.
  • Foster a positive and collaborative work environment within the kitchen team.
  • Monitor and manage inventory for your station, including ingredients, supplies and portion control to minimize waste.
  • Assist in ordering supplies and ensuring stock rotation to maintain freshness.
  • Collaborate with the Pastry Chef and other kitchen hoteliers to coordinate dessert production.
  • Support the broader culinary team during high-volume periods or special events.
  • Stay up to date on culinary trends, techniques and ingredients to bring innovation into the menu.
  • Accommodate special guest requests such as dietary restrictions or custom-made desserts (gluten free, vegan, low sugar, etc.) while maintaining quality and presentation.
  • Contribute creative ideas to enhance dessert menus or special offerings, such as afternoon tea or wedding cakes.
  • Adhere to strict food safety and sanitation regulations, including HACCP and local codes.
  • Ensure proper handling, storage and labeling of ingredients to prevent cross contamination.
  • Maintain a clean and safe kitchen environment, including regular cleaning of equipment and workspaces.
